I really wanted to like this series and for most of its ingredients, I do (story, lore, characters, companion interactions, exploring). I started Origins about four times and always had enough of it at some point. Only recently, I figured out that my main problem is the real-time with pause combat. Somehow it clicked that it's the same reason I couldn't bother to finish Baldur's Gate 2. Call me shallow, but it bothers me when I'm out there trying to explore the world, then BANG!, you're attacked, it's a strategy game all of a sudden (seriously, for me, it's like a different game, it breaks the immersion). And in most cases I do not like strategy games (there are some exceptions, but then I play those.) And I couldn't get my head around the tactics system 😅That would help a bit though. It's only my two cents and I absolutely understand how it can be a favourite for so many people, but guess it's just not for me. Just had to get this off my chest.
